(I love the exuberant color of red/purple cabbage and think it sound just right for a wedding!)Vicki Lanehttps://www.blogger.com/profile/08114677510459055768no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-764237570467034909.post-50037683069104210112010-04-24T16:42:36.234-04:002010-04-24T16:42:36.234-04:00Well we also call a proxy marriage a glove marriag...Well we also call a proxy marriage a glove marriage. My parents met when my father was on <br />leave in the Netherlands for a year. He was an engineer on board of a <br />merchant ship.<br />Every sixth year in Indonesia ( then Dutch East Indies), he and other <br />sailors had to go back to the Netherlands in order to study for a new <br />certificate. There was no time to marry in Holland so they decided to marry <br />by proxy, after the wedding ceremony my mum was to travel to Java by ship, while my father was <br />back at work on one of the Dutch ships of his company. My mother didn't wear <br />a weddingdress, but she had a nice dress in a "red cabbage" colour. At least <br />that's what she told. Her father-in-law ran up the flight of steps of the <br />townhall and she ran after him. By-standers were shocked to see a young <br />woman getting married to an old man, like my grandfather. They didn't know <br />about the proxy arrangement of course. My mum thought it funny, but my <br />granddad did not like it at all. Anyway my father got a telegram saying that <br />he was married! At that moment he was working in the engine room in his <br />boilersuit. I bet he was happy to miss a weddingceremony with many relatives and <br />friends shaking hands and smiling all the time. He didn't like to stand on <br />ceremony! The voyage from the Netherlands to Indonesia took one month. So my <br />parents had been married over a month before they saw each other. Mum was 21 <br />and dad was 24 years old. They got their first child (me) six years later, <br />when my father had been in Holland on leave again. He went to Indonesia <br />ahead and my mum waited until I was born a month later. She waited till I <br />was a few months old before returning to Indonesia.
